Reconciling sub ledgers to GL and Tracking revenue adjustments on lowest detail level

CornerStar's Revenue Adjustment Models ensures Sales Analytics data ties out to the financial statements.

Problem: Each month, our client makes hundreds of adjustments to the revenue values calculated by its ERP sales order module—a fairly common problem. They defer service and contract revenue and accrue monthly. They accrue confirmed (not yet received) return material authorizations. Often, they adjust revenue credit amongst sales territories. Manual journal entries were created and manual adjustments were made to revenue reports. Reconciling the GL to the sales reports was next to impossible.

Solution: CornerStar addresses these problems with a Revenue Adjustment Module. This prepackaged bolt-on actually adds power to the client's source systems. It provides a single source of entry for adjustments that affect both the General Ledger and Sales Data Mart. The module handles the synchronized updating of both the Sales and Financial Data Marts, ensuring that sales and financial reports are kept in line with the latest revenue adjustments at a detailed as well as a summarized level.
